Na Liu

Na Liu (born 7 February 1983)[1] is a British table tennis player.

Biography

Liu was born in Liao Ning, China and began playing table tennis at age seven.[1][2]

She has lived in Belfast, Northern Ireland since 2001, gaining British citizenship in 2008.[1][2]

In 2010, she represented Northern Ireland at the Commonwealth Games in Delhi, India.[1][3] In 2012, she competed for Great Britain at the Summer Olympics in London, where she landed in the ninth position[4] after losing three games against Kim Jong.[5]
